Understanding the Importance of Leg Workouts

Leg workouts are essential for several reasons. Primarily, they engage some of the largest muscle groups in the body, including the quadriceps, hamstrings, glutes, and calves. Strengthening these muscles contributes to improved overall strength, better balance, and enhanced athletic performance. Additionally, effective leg workouts can aid in weight management, improved metabolic rate, and injury prevention by fostering a robust foundation for all physical activities.

Key Exercises for Legs Without Equipment

Effective leg workouts can be constructed from various bodyweight exercises. Here are some fundamental movements to include:

  • Squats: Targets quadriceps, hamstrings, and glutes. Variations include sumo and jump squats.
  • Lunges: Engages multiple leg muscles. Forward, reverse, and side lunges provide variety.
  • Glute Bridges: Focuses on glutes and hamstrings, promoting hip stability and strength.
  • Calf Raises: Strengthens calves; can be performed on flat ground or with toes elevated on a step.

Step-by-Step Workout Routine

A well-structured workout can yield excellent results even in a brief timeframe. Below is a simple no equipment leg workout routine:

  1. Warm-Up: 3-5 minutes of light jogging or dynamic stretches.
  2. Perform 3 sets of the following exercises:
  • Squats: 15-20 repetitions
  • Lunges: 10-15 repetitions per leg
  • Glute Bridges: 15-20 repetitions
  • Calf Raises: 15-20 repetitions
  • Cool Down: 3-5 minutes of stretching, focusing on the lower body.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Can I build muscle with no equipment leg workouts?

    Yes, bodyweight exercises can effectively build muscle strength, especially when performed with proper form and progressive overload.

    How often should I do leg workouts?

    For optimal results, aim to perform leg workouts 2-3 times per week, allowing rest days for recovery.

    Will no equipment workouts lead to weight loss?

    Yes, consistent no equipment workouts, combined with proper nutrition, can contribute to weight loss and improved fitness.

    Is it necessary to warm up before workouts?

    Yes, warming up prepares the body for physical activity, increasing blood flow and reducing the risk of injury.

    Can beginners do these leg workouts?

    Absolutely! These exercises can be adapted for all fitness levels, making them suitable for beginners.

    Do I need to stretch after workouts?

    Yes, cooling down and stretching post-workout helps reduce muscle soreness and improve flexibility.
